You will join the Energy Management business unit, which includes activities such as the supply, purchase, sale (trading) and shipment of oil, biofuels, natural gas, electricity and environmental products, both from Galp's own capital and from third parties.These operations add value throughout Galp's integrated business chain, as they seek to proactively seize commercial opportunities, maximise integrated margins and navigate the dynamics and volatility of the energy market.

You will be part of Galp's Trading Strategies & Market Intelligence team in the Supply & Trading Americas area and will participate in activities related to energy planning studies for energy price forecasting, thermoelectric dispatch forecasting and credit and market risk management to support decision-making and optimisation of Galp's trading and own energy portfolios (electricity and natural gas). In addition, you will actively participate in the day-to-day internal routines of the area and will always be involved in the continuous improvement of internal processes and routines through the development of support tools, reports, and automation of routines and processes. Team spirit is essential, as there is direct interaction with the front and back office areas, natural gas programming and the portfolio management area. Short- and medium-term energy price simulations, using Newave/Decomp/Dessem operating models through monitoring and sensitivity analyses of the main factors that impact energy prices, including but not limited to:
- Flow rates and natural inflow energy;
- Stored Energy;
- Energy Load;
- Meteorology;
- Exchange Limits;
- Hydraulic, Electrical and Volume Restrictions;
- Development of tools and reports in Excel, VBA, Python and PowerBi to support the analyses required by the area, in addition to routine activities.
